The Falklands War ended on June 14th 1982, 40 years ago today.
I was a part of 3 Commando Brigade Air Squadron at the time, and sailed down there immediately after a 3 month deployment in northern Norway, stopping on the way at Ascension Island, and stooging around the Atlantic Ocean while politicians decided why we were there in the first place.
This is a short story of my memories of that time, some good, some bad, some humorous. I was a 22 year old soldier at the time, but many of the tales are still fresh in my mind. It was truly a life forming experience, and not one that you'd want to live too many times.
